In any case, knowledge of these terms is necessary to understanding the games and rules of betting:
ACTION: Any type of wager.
ALL-IN: In poker, all-in means a gambler has deposited all of their money into the pot. A second pot is developed for the bettors with additional chips.
ALL-UP: To bet on many horses in the identical contest.
ANTE: A poker term for allocating a specified figure of chips into the pot just beforeevery hand starts.
BRING-IN: A required wager in seven-card stud made by the gambler showing the lowest value card.
BUST: You don’t win; As in vingt-et-un, when a player’s cards are valued over twenty-one.
BUY-IN: The minimal sum of chips necessary to appear in a game or tournament.
CALL: As in poker, when a bet equals an already carried out wager.
CHECK: In poker, to remain in the match without betting. This is acceptable only if no other players wager in that round.
CLOSING A BET: As in spread betting, meaning to put a wager equal to but opposite of the first bet.
COLUMN BET: To bet on one or more of the 3 columns of a roulette table.
COME BET: In craps, close to a pass-line wager, but carried out after the shooter has achieved her point.
COME-OUT ROLL: A crapshooters 1st toss to ascertain a number, or the 1st roll after a point has been established.
COVERALL: A bingo term, which means to fill all the numbers on a bingo card.
CRAPPING OUT: In craps, to roll a 2, 3 or 12 is an immediate loss on the come-out toss.
DAILY DOUBLE: To pick the champions of the first two events of the day.
DOWN BET: To wager that the result of an action will be lower than the smallest end of the quote on a spread bet, also known as a "sell".
DOZEN BET: In roulette, to gamble on any of 3 sets of twelve numbers, one-12, etc.
EACH WAY BET: A athletic event wager, which means to bet on a team or player to succeed or position in a match.
EVEN MONEY BET: A wager that pays out the same sum as gambled, ( 1:1 ).
EXACTA: Betting that 2 horses in a race will complete the race in the absolute same order as the wager – also known as a " Perfecta ".
FIVE-NUMBER LINE BET: In roulette, a wager carried out on a grouping of five numbers, like 1-2-3-0, and 00.
